Hangi hücrede veri varsa istenilen hücreye o gelsin

Katılım
25 Haziran 2006
Mesajlar
183
Excel Vers. ve Dili
Excel 2003 TR SP2
A2 B2 C2 D2 hücrelerinden hangisinde veri varsa o veri belirlediğimiz A5 hücresine yazsın. Yardımcı olursanız sevinirim teşekkürler.
 

İdris SERDAR

Moderatör
Yönetici
Katılım
21 Ekim 2005
Mesajlar
17,104
Excel Vers. ve Dili
Excel, 365 - İngilizce
=EĞER(A2<>0;A2;EĞER(B2<>0;B2;EĞER(C2<>0;C2;EĞER(D2<>0;D2;EĞER(E2<>0;E2;"")))))

formülünü deneyin.
 

Mahmut Bayram

Özel Üye
Katılım
25 Haziran 2005
Mesajlar
1,778
Excel Vers. ve Dili
2016 Excel Tr
Makrolu çözüm isterseniz eğer
Kod:
Sub doluhucre_yaz()
Dim ran
Sheets("Sayfa1").Activate
ran = range("A2:E2").Select
For Each ran In Selection
If ran > 0 Then
   range("A5").Value = ran.Value
End If
Next
End Sub
 
Katılım
25 Haziran 2006
Mesajlar
183
Excel Vers. ve Dili
Excel 2003 TR SP2
Sn. yurttas teşekkür ederim
bu form doldurmaişleri çok zorinanınız ki word dosyasında hazırlasak o zamanda hesap makinesi ile uğraşmamız lazım hiç işin içinden çıkamazdık. SİZLERE NE KADAR TEŞEKKÜR ETSEM azdır emeğinize sağlık.

şöyle bir uyarı getirebilir miyiz acaba öğretmen yanlışlıkla 2 hücreye veri girsin ama bir tanesi o hücreye yazılacağından hata mesajı verdirebilir miyiz.
mesela: hatalı giriş yaptınız gibi
teşekkürler
 
Katılım
25 Haziran 2006
Mesajlar
183
Excel Vers. ve Dili
Excel 2003 TR SP2
Makrolu çözüm isterseniz eğer
Kod:
Sub doluhucre_yaz()
Dim ran
Sheets("Sayfa1").Activate
ran = range("A2:E2").Select
For Each ran In Selection
If ran > 0 Then
   range("A5").Value = ran.Value
End If
Next
End Sub
Partner hocam ben bunu düğmeye mi atayacağım direkt vba ya yazsam çalışırmı bu o hücrede :( sizler kadar işin erbabı değilim inan ki anlayamadım
 

İdris SERDAR

Moderatör
Yönetici
Katılım
21 Ekim 2005
Mesajlar
17,104
Excel Vers. ve Dili
Excel, 365 - İngilizce
=EĞER(BAĞ_DEĞ_DOLU_SAY(A2:E2)>1;"BİRDEN FAZLA VERİ GİRDİNİZ!...";EĞER(A2<>0;A2;EĞER(B2<>0;B2;EĞER(C2<>0;C2;EĞER(D2<>0;D2;EĞER(E2<>0;E2;""))))))

Bunu deneyin.
 
Katılım
25 Haziran 2006
Mesajlar
183
Excel Vers. ve Dili
Excel 2003 TR SP2
Say&#305; &#214;rnek Dosyada A&#231;&#305;klama Yapm&#305;&#351;t&#305;m Saolsunlar Yard&#305;mci Oldular Arkada&#351;lar
 
Üst